Inspired by traditional Japanese drumming, San Jose Taiko expresses the beauty and harmony of the human spirit through the voice of the taiko, or Japanese drum. Celebrating Japanese heritage while transcending cultural boundaries, San Jose Taiko broadens the historical art form into a style that intertwines traditional Japanese drumming with the beat of other world rhythms including African, Balinese, Brazilian, Latin and jazz percussion. The resulting sounds are contemporary, exciting, new and innovative, bridging many styles while still resonant of the Asian soul in America. This exciting performance includes three energetic performers, explanations of the history and philosophy of this form of Japanese drumming -- and on-stage student participation!
